After finishing Orlando Murrin’s A Table in the Tarn and reading about his work before he moved to France, I bought oliveone of the three BBC magazines on food and cooking he helped create and I’m so glad I did. 



Its’ concept of – eat in (for recipes), eat out (for restaurants), eat away (for travel) – is informative and interesting.  The recipes are seasonal and simple, the restaurant reviews straightforward and the travel articles informative and well-written.  It’s a pity I can’t buy it here in Spain but I do get a chance to pick up a copy when I cross the border to Gibraltar and  do my shopping at Morrisons.
